We just celebrated my husband, Shehab’s 30th birthday! He’s officially old! We don’t typically make birthdays a big deal but his 30th caused for a little celebration. I decided to do 30 gifts for 30 years but didn’t realize how difficult it would be to figure out 30 gifts for a GUY! I mean I can barely think of one decent gift that isn’t athletic gear. In addition to the 30 gifts, I wanted to do a little decoration with a ton of balloons. To be honest, this part was mostly for me and for our almost 2 year old. She was so excited to see all those balloons on the wall. She came down the stairs yelling “wowww boooon!” I stayed up till 2 am blowing and putting up the balloons but it was so worth it!
This idea could have easily gotten out of hand but I got most of the items for less than $5. Some of the most expensive items went up to only $20. I got a mix of some funny items like a Tide to go stain remover since he’s always complaining about stains on his clothes.I also got some functional things like office supplies for his home office. I wrapped everything in the same wrapping paper I picked up from the dollar store and numbered it 1-30. Some gift ideas included:
- Tide to go stain remover
- Wet wipes
- Razor blades
- Mini hand lotion
- Gum
- Bath Towel
- Bath salts
- Blackhead nose strips
- Socks
- Ground coffee
- “Best Dad Ever” mug
- Toddler soccer ball (so he can start training Hoda)
- Bar soap
- Sticky notes
- Pens
- Dry erase board (for his office)
- Snacks (protein bars, chocolate etc)
- Phone charger
